#360258 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#360258 is composed of 21.2% red, 0.8%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.6% cyan, 97.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 276.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 17.6%. #360258 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c04b0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#360258 color description : Very dark violet.

#360258 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#360258 has RGB values of R:54, G:2,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 3539544.

Shades and Tints of #360258

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07000b is the darkest color, while #fcf7ff is the lightest one.
